ABOUT THIS JOB

Position Specific Description

The Organizational Development and Training Manager at the City of Tucsons Water Department develops and administers programs related to the professional development of staff and professionalization of the utility as a whole through the lenses of people processes and technology. Projects in this area include efforts to meet or exceed industry standards and best practices across all functional areas. The team acts as internal consultants to department leadership in all aspects of the items above.

Work is performed under the supervision of the Water Administrator. This position supervises the organizational development and training section.

Duties and Responsibilities

  • Manages the departments internal and vendor-provided training programs and resources including administration of the Learning Management System to ensure comprehensive and robust technical and professional development training.
  • Advises department leadership on industry best practices and standards; develops and manages improvement projects as necessary.
  • Maintain and improve the departments professionalism through knowledge management and transfer programs and continuous improvement projects.
  • Leads the departments new hire onboarding program to ensure effective and efficient integration of new personnel into the organization.
  • Manages coordinates and determines priorities of work monitoring levels of resources establishing timelines assigning work monitoring progress recommending changes and suggestions writing reviewing and editing reports prepared by staff and approving completed projects and reports.
  • Provides customer service by responding to information requests conducting research providing solutions to problems and correcting errors.
  • Performs all other tasks and duties as assigned.

All duties and responsibilities listed are subject to change.

M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S

Education
Bachelors Degree

Experience
Five (5) years of directly related experience

*Any combination of relevant education and experience may be substituted on a year for year basis

Preferred Qualifications
Masters degree in public administration organizational leadership or related field
Public or private water utility experience
Supervisory experience

Benefits: The City of Tucson offers a generous benefits package for benefit-eligible positions. The comprehensive flexible and affordable coverage is designed to optimize health and well-being security and future and peace of mind. Benefits begin with medical dental vision life disability and FSA coverage surpassing your standard 401(k) program by offering a rich pension plan plus optional Roth and pretax deferred compensation savings. With your well-being in mind our paid time off program provides new hires with 38 paid days off in the first year of employment with time off increasing steadily in subsequent years. We offer twelve weeks of paid parental leave paid tuition reimbursement student loan repayment off- and on-the-job training and opportunities to forge connections with peers and the community through employee resource groups and paid volunteer hours.
